@Gfreed...this is really a listening thing. So many people have such thick accents and sometimes "y" comes out as a hard "j", lots of people don't even bother with pronouncing "s", and still others drop "d". People in Spain and Puerto Rico are famed for that. So, it comes down to the skill of listening...which is not an easy skill, in any language. Just ask my wife!
